@@ -2604,6 +2604,7 @@ interface ARIAMixin {
2604
2604
ariaValueNow: string | null;
2605
2605
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Element/ariaValueText) */
2606
2606
ariaValueText: string | null;
2607
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Element/role) */
2607
2608
role: string | null;
2608
2609
}
2609
2610
@@ -6796,6 +6797,7 @@ interface DOMMatrix extends DOMMatrixReadOnly {
6796
6797
rotateSelf(rotX?: number, rotY?: number, rotZ?: number): DOMMatrix;
6797
6798
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/DOMMatrix/scale3dSelf) */
6798
6799
scale3dSelf(scale?: number, originX?: number, originY?: number, originZ?: number): DOMMatrix;
6800
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/DOMMatrix/scaleSelf) */
6799
6801
scaleSelf(scaleX?: number, scaleY?: number, scaleZ?: number, originX?: number, originY?: number, originZ?: number): DOMMatrix;
6800
6802
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/DOMMatrix/setMatrixValue) */
6801
6803
setMatrixValue(transformList: string): DOMMatrix;
@@ -11128,7 +11130,9 @@ interface HTMLFormElement extends HTMLElement {
11128
11130
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LFormElement/noValidate)
11129
11131
*/
11130
11132
noValidate: boolean;
11133
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LFormElement/rel) */
11131
11134
rel: string;
11135
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LFormElement/relList) */
11132
11136
readonly relList: DOMTokenList;
11133
11137
/**
11134
11138
* Sets or retrieves the window or frame at which to target content.
@@ -11548,7 +11552,7 @@ interface HTMLIFrameElement extends HTMLElement {
11548
11552
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LIFrameElement/width)
11549
11553
*/
11550
11554
width: string;
11551
- /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LIframeElement /getSVGDocument) */
11555
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LIFrameElement /getSVGDocument) */
11552
11556
getSVGDocument(): Document | null;
11553
11557
addEventListener<K extends keyof HTMLElementEventMap>(type: K, listener: (this: HTMLIFrameElement, ev: HTMLElementEventMap[K]) => any, options?: boolean | AddEventListenerOptions): void;
11554
11558
addEventListener(type: string, listener: EventListenerOrEventListenerObject, options?: boolean | AddEventListenerOptions): void;
@@ -11751,6 +11755,7 @@ interface HTMLInputElement extends HTMLElement, PopoverInvokerElement {
11751
11755
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LInputElement/defaultValue)
11752
11756
*/
11753
11757
defaultValue: string;
11758
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LInputElement/dirName) */
11754
11759
dirName: string;
11755
11760
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LInputElement/disabled) */
11756
11761
disabled: boolean;
@@ -14035,6 +14040,7 @@ interface HTMLTextAreaElement extends HTMLElement {
14035
14040
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LTextAreaElement/defaultValue)
14036
14041
*/
14037
14042
defaultValue: string;
14043
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LTextAreaElement/dirName) */
14038
14044
dirName: string;
14039
14045
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/HTMLTextAreaElement/disabled) */
14040
14046
disabled: boolean;
@@ -16961,6 +16967,12 @@ interface Navigator extends NavigatorAutomationInformation, NavigatorBadge, Navi
16961
16967
readonly doNotTrack: string | null;
16962
16968
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Navigator/geolocation) */
16963
16969
readonly geolocation: Geolocation;
16970
+ /**
16971
+ * Available only in secure contexts.
16972
+ *
16973
+ * [MDN Reference](https://developer.mozilla.org/docs/Web/API/Navigator/login)
16974
+ */
16975
+ readonly login: NavigatorLogin;
16964
16976
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Navigator/maxTouchPoints) */
16965
16977
readonly maxTouchPoints: number;
16966
16978
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Navigator/mediaCapabilities) */
@@ -17120,6 +17132,21 @@ interface NavigatorLocks {
17120
17132
readonly locks: LockManager;
17121
17133
}
17122
17134
17135
+ /**
17136
+ * Available only in secure contexts.
17137
+ *
17138
+ * [MDN Reference](https://developer.mozilla.org/docs/Web/API/NavigatorLogin)
17139
+ */
17140
+ interface NavigatorLogin {
17141
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/NavigatorLogin/setStatus) */
17142
+ setStatus(status: LoginStatus): Promise<void>;
17143
+ }
17144
+
17145
+ declare var NavigatorLogin: {
17146
+ prototype: NavigatorLogin;
17147
+ new(): NavigatorLogin;
17148
+ };
17149
+
17123
17150
interface NavigatorOnLine {
17124
17151
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Navigator/onLine) */
17125
17152
readonly onLine: boolean;
@@ -21406,6 +21433,7 @@ declare var SVGGraphicsElement: {
21406
21433
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GImageElement)
21407
21434
*/
21408
21435
interface SVGImageElement extends SVGGraphicsElement, SVGURIReference {
21436
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GImageElement/crossOrigin) */
21409
21437
crossOrigin: string | null;
21410
21438
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GImageElement/height) */
21411
21439
readonly height: SVGAnimatedLength;
@@ -21712,8 +21740,11 @@ declare var SVGNumberList: {
21712
21740
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GPathElement)
21713
21741
*/
21714
21742
interface SVGPathElement extends SVGGeometryElement {
21743
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GPathElement/pathLength) */
21715
21744
readonly pathLength: SVGAnimatedNumber;
21745
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GPathElement/getPointAtLength) */
21716
21746
getPointAtLength(distance: number): DOMPoint;
21747
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GPathElement/getTotalLength) */
21717
21748
getTotalLength(): number;
21718
21749
addEventListener<K extends keyof SVGElementEventMap>(type: K, listener: (this: SVGPathElement, ev: SVGElementEventMap[K]) => any, options?: boolean | AddEventListenerOptions): void;
21719
21750
addEventListener(type: string, listener: EventListenerOrEventListenerObject, options?: boolean | AddEventListenerOptions): void;
@@ -22273,6 +22304,7 @@ interface SVGTextPositioningElement extends SVGTextContentElement {
22273
22304
readonly dx: SVGAnimatedLengthList;
22274
22305
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GTextPositioningElement/dy) */
22275
22306
readonly dy: SVGAnimatedLengthList;
22307
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GTextPositioningElement/rotate) */
22276
22308
readonly rotate: SVGAnimatedNumberList;
22277
22309
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/SVGTextPositioningElement/x) */
22278
22310
readonly x: SVGAnimatedLengthList;
@@ -27273,6 +27305,8 @@ interface Window extends EventTarget, AnimationFrameProvider, GlobalEventHandler
27273
27305
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/orientation)
27274
27306
*/
27275
27307
readonly orientation: number;
27308
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/originAgentCluster) */
27309
+ readonly originAgentCluster: boolean;
27276
27310
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/outerHeight) */
27277
27311
readonly outerHeight: number;
27278
27312
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/outerWidth) */
@@ -28910,6 +28944,8 @@ declare var opener: any;
28910
28944
* [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/orientation)
28911
28945
*/
28912
28946
declare var orientation: number;
28947
+ /**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/originAgentCluster) */
28948
+ declare var originAgentCluster: boolean;
28913
28949
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/outerHeight) */
28914
28950
declare var outerHeight: number;
28915
28951
/** [MDN Reference](https://developer.mozilla.org/docs/Web/API/Window/outerWidth) */
@@ -29772,6 +29808,7 @@ type KeyUsage = "decrypt" | "deriveBits" | "deriveKey" | "encrypt" | "sign" | "u
29772
29808
type LatencyMode = "quality" | "realtime";
29773
29809
type LineAlignSetting = "center" | "end" | "start";
29774
29810
type LockMode = "exclusive" | "shared";
29811
+ type LoginStatus = "logged-in" | "logged-out";
29775
29812
type MIDIPortConnectionState = "closed" | "open" | "pending";
29776
29813
type MIDIPortDeviceState = "connected" | "disconnected";
29777
29814
type MIDIPortType = "input" | "output";
0 commit comments